Established in 1943, the mission of the SDSU Research Foundation (SDSURF) is to support the research objectives of San Diego State University by helping faculty and staff find, obtain, and administer funding for their research and sponsored programs. SDSU achieved its strategic plan goal of becoming an R1, premier public research university in early 2025 furthering discoveries, interventions, and solutions that improve communities and change the world. SDSURF provides the full life cycle of grants services to faculty and staff to further their important work.

Academy for Professional Excellence, a project of San Diego State University School of Social Work, was established in 1996 with the goal of revolutionizing the way people work to ensure the world is a healthier place. Our services integrate culturally responsive and recovery\-oriented practices into our daily work to promote healing and healthy relationships. Providing approximately 50,000 learning experiences to health and human service and justice system professionals annually, the Academy provides a variety of workforce development solutions in Southern California and beyond. With seven programs, three divisions and over 100 staff, the Academy’s mission is to provide exceptional learning and development experiences for the transformation of individuals, organizations, and communities.

Responsibilities:

PURPOSE OF THE POSITION

===========================

Under the general direction of the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or, the Recruitment \& Engagement Specialist is responsible for working closely with the Organizational Development Team to implement and facilitate organization development strategic efforts with a focus on recruitment and employee engagement in alignment with the Academy’s vision, promise, mission, and System of Practice.SPECIFIC DUTIES

===================

This is a 40\-hour a week, full\-time hybrid with remote flexibility position working M\-F from 8:00 to 4:30 p.m. and is based on contract funding subject to annual renewal. This position requires that you reside within California throughout the duration of your employment and live within a commutable distance from the worksite your work supports. Positions are typically assigned to either our Riverside or San Diego office for any on\-site work.

Note: some duties may include working with and/or exposure to sensitive/traumatic topics or material dealing with child abuse, abuse against older adults and adults with disabilities, and/or issues and scenarios related to mental health, substance use, or racism.

The Academy is a project of the San Diego State University Research Foundation, which is grant\-funded and serves as an auxiliary to the University. The Academy is based near, but not on campus, and does not have direct responsibilities for working with or teaching college students.

The Academy is currently going through a reclassification process. If this position’s classification changes during this process, it would not change the role, responsibilities, or compensation of the position. RECRUITMENT SUPPORT (55%) Specific Duties

Assist the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or and Hiring Authorities with responsibilities relating to: recruitment, on\-boarding, and exiting of Academy staff:

  • Act as a primary contact for Hiring Authorities during recruitment processes under the guidance of the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or.
  • Serve as the lead staff member for Training Host and Training Operations Assistant (TOA) recruitment processes.
  • Create and update hiring authority resource folders in order to ensure that interview panels and Hiring Authorities have the proper resources they need.
  • Support Hiring Authorities through the recruitment process, direct them to relevant resources, and address their questions in a timely manner.
  • Work with SDSU Research Foundation Human Resources’s applicant tracking system (ATS) to post new positions, create and organize applicant packages, and enter candidate ratings.
  • Communicate with and schedule interviews for prospective candidates and address candidate questions as they arise in line with HR guidance.
  • Draft, post, and monitor LinkedIn and social media campaigns for all recruitments.
  • Coordinate the on\-boarding of new employees and update protocols and templates as directed by the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or.
  • Send out and collect responses for candidate experience assessment and share back data via a quarterly report.
  • Use the Academy’s project management system to document and track your recruitment and onboarding work.
  • Support the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or in guiding people leaders and exiting Academy staff through Academy/HR exit protocols and procedures.
  • Work with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or and Executive Director to ensure exit interviews are conducted properly.
  • Assist in updating Academy protocols and procedures related to the hiring, on\-boarding, and exiting of Academy staff.
  • Assist Leadership Development/Hiring Supervisor in the review of best practice resources as directed to identify recruitment improvements in alignment with the Academy System of Practice.
